Description and Introduction

Ultra-Low Supply Current/Supply Voltage Supervisory Circuits The TPS3103K33DBVT is a voltage supervisor and reset IC manufactured by Texas Instruments (TI). Here are its key specifications, descriptions, and features:

### **Manufacturer:**  
Texas Instruments (TI)  

### **Part Number:**  
TPS3103K33DBVT  

### **Description:**  
The TPS3103K33DBVT is a low-power voltage supervisor designed to monitor system voltage levels and provide a reset signal when the voltage falls below a preset threshold. It ensures proper system initialization and operation.  

### **Key Features:**  
- **Supply Voltage Range:** 0.7V to 6V  
- **Threshold Voltage:** 3.08V (fixed for TPS3103K33 variant)  
- **Reset Output:** Active-low open-drain (RESET)  
- **Low Quiescent Current:** 1.2µA (typical)  
- **Adjustable Reset Delay Time:** Configurable via an external capacitor  
- **Operating Temperature Range:** -40°C to +125°C  
- **Package:** SOT-23-5 (DBV)  

### **Applications:**  
- Microprocessor/microcontroller reset supervision  
- Battery-powered systems  
- Industrial and automotive electronics  
- Portable and embedded systems  

This IC ensures reliable system operation by monitoring voltage levels and generating a reset signal when necessary.
